Improving Efficiency Using a Hybrid Approach: Revising an Intravenous/Blood Workshop in a Clinical Research

Debra A Parchen1, Sandra E Phelps, Eunice M Johnson

  • 1Debra A. Parchen, MSN, RN, OCN®, is a Nurse Educator at the National Institutes of Health Clinical Center Nursing Department, Bethesda, Maryland. Sandra E. Phelps, MSN, RN, is a Nurse Consultant at the Centers for Medicare and Medicaid Services Center for Clinical Standards and Quality*, Baltimore, Maryland. Eunice M. Johnson, MSN, RN, is a Nurse Consultant within Community Health in Franklin County, Pennsylvania. Cheryl A. Fisher, EdD, RN-BC, is a Senior Nurse Consultant for Extramural Collaborations at the National Institutes of Health Clinical Center Nursing Department, Bethesda, Maryland.

Journal for Nurses in Professional Development
|May 18, 2016
PubMed
Summary

New nurses can master essential skills like intravenous (IV) therapy and blood administration through a redesigned workshop. This comprehensive training prepares them for complex research environments, enhancing patient care.

Area of Science:

  • Nursing Education
  • Clinical Skills Training
  • Healthcare Professional Development

Background:

  • Onboarding new nurses presents challenges, particularly in acquiring specialized skills like intravenous (IV) therapy and blood administration.
  • Nurses in research-intensive settings require specific competencies for patient care protocols.

Purpose of the Study:

  • To redesign the Intravenous (IV)/Blood Workshop at the National Institutes of Health Clinical Center Nursing Department.
  • To equip nurses with essential skills for patient care in a research-intensive environment.

Main Methods:

  • Implemented innovative teaching strategies and a hybrid instructional approach.
  • Incorporated a pre-workshop activity, hands-on skills lab practice, and unit-level skill validation.
  • Focused on comprehensive curriculum delivery while optimizing resource utilization.

Main Results:

  • The redesigned workshop effectively prepared nurses with necessary IV therapy and blood administration skills.
  • The hybrid approach and structured practice enhanced skill acquisition and retention.
  • Resource utilization was decreased through efficient curriculum design.

Conclusions:

  • The revised IV/Blood Workshop provides a robust and resource-efficient model for orienting nurses.
  • This program enhances nursing preparedness for specialized roles in research settings.
  • Continuous skill validation ensures sustained competency in critical care procedures.
